In the '[[Daylight]]' [[Legion of Lawndale Heroes]] continuum, the '''United States Marshals Service''' is the sole remaining law-enforcement agency empowered by the existing U.S. Government. The exact number of U.S. Marshals is unknown, but (at present) the USMS is the largest known force operating on American soil. (The USMS numbers about three to four times the number of the [[United States Military Command[[]], as all surviving law-enforcement were immediately absorbed into the service; also, the ability of the USMS to 'deputize' new Special Deputy Marshals allows them to create new members faster than the training regimen required for new USMC personnel.
 
In addition to law-enforcement, the USMS also acts as the representatives of the government in matters of administrative duties at the local level. In addition, the USMS can be used by the government to 'carry out unusual or extraordinary missions'; this broad definition of the agency's jurisdictional scope means that in many cases, the USMS can and will engage in a wide variety of activities in the current environment.
